April 12, 20224 yr Hi Jose, 4 hours ago, DJJose said: Is it possible to one day add a weather radar overlay or incorporate the windy website to show weather info during flights? This is planned but more for a far future version, sorry. 4 hours ago, DJJose said: I also get a red message that the airplane (Concorde) profile does not match the DCD Concorde in MSFS. Is there a way to instruct LNM to automatically update the Airplane profile to match the Concorde version? Looks like the Concorde reports a not matching type. You can easily fix this by adapting the aircraft type: Menu "Aircraft" -> "Edit aircraft performance" and then change the field "Aircraft Type" to whatever the aircraft from the sim reports. Save this and the message is gone. Seems that the Concorde has no official ICAO desginator at all. Alex Alex' Projects: Little Navmap
